Can dogs eat an Oreo? No – unfortunately not. Specialists answer the question of whether chocolate is toxic to dogs unequivocally with “yes.” Dogs have a completely different metabolism than humans. Even small amounts of chocolate can have a toxic effect.
Why can’t a dog eat onions? Raw onions and garlic: even one medium sized onion can be fatal to a medium sized dog because the sulfur compounds in the onion and garlic cause the red blood cells in the dog’s blood to break down (called hemolysis).
How much chocolate does a dog have to eat to die? In sensitive dogs, doses as low as 90 to 250 mg per kilogram of body weight can be fatal to the dog. At a consumption of 300 mg, the so-called 50 percent lethal dose is already reached. This means that half of all dogs die when ingesting this amount.

What is oreos?
The classic Oreo is a double cookie made of two cookie pieces, dark browned due to the cocoa they contain and bound together with a white vanilla flavored filling. The cookies taste chocolaty tart, the filling sweet.
What to do if the dog ate onion?
If your pet has eaten onions or garlic and is now passing brown urine, is weak, panting or breathing faster, you should go to the vet immediately. Your pet may need oxygen, an IV, or even a blood transfusion to survive.
How toxic are cooked onions in a dog?
Onion plants are all toxic to dogs and cats fresh, cooked, fried, dried, liquid and powdered. There is as yet no established lowest dose at which poisoning occurs. It is known that dogs show blood picture changes from 15-30g onions per kilogram body weight.
How fast does a dog die from chocolate?
After ingestion of a large amount of chocolate, symptoms of poisoning can occur after only two hours and death after at least twelve hours. Symptoms are mainly dose-dependent – and this in turn depends on the type of chocolate.
Can chocolate be deadly for dogs?
Even small amounts of chocolate can have a toxic effect. Chocolate is toxic for your dog. It contains theobromine. Dogs break down this ingredient only slowly.
What happens when the dog eats chocolate?
Dog ate chocolate: Symptoms of poisoning Go to the vet as soon as possible! The faster your darling is treated, the better. In the worst case, cardiac arrhythmias and coma and even death are possible if the dog has eaten chocolate.

What is dangerous for puppies?
Raw legumes and dogs Raw legumes such as lentils and beans contain phasin. This toxic substance inhibits protein biosynthesis in the small intestine and clumps red blood cells. Too much ingested phasin can therefore be life-threatening for your dog.

What’s in Oreos?
Ingredients: WHEAT FLOUR, sugar, palm fat, low-fat cocoa powder 4.6%, WHEAT STARCH, glucose-fructose syrup, raising agents (potassium hydrogen carbonate, ammonium hydrogen carbonate, sodium hydrogen carbonate), table salt, palm kernel fat, emulsifiers (SOJALECITHIN, sunflower lecithin), flavoring (vanillin). May contain milk.
How much onions can a dog eat?
Even small amounts can cause the poisoning. A medium sized onion is about enough to cause severe poisoning symptoms in a small dog. The toxic dose is given as about 15-30 g per kg of your dog’s body weight.
Can you give onion to a dog?
Raw onions are toxic to dogs from 5 to 10 grams per kilogram of body weight, which means that a medium-sized onion (200-250g) can be toxic to a medium-sized dog. Poisoning usually begins with vomiting and diarrhea.
Are fried onions poisonous for dogs?
If your dog has eaten raw, fried or cooked onions you should always consult your veterinarian. Even very small amounts can cause symptoms of poisoning, depending on the size of your dog. Your dog may need a blood transfusion.
